VICI Properties Maintains Quarterly Dividend at $0.45 per Share
Event summary
- VICI Properties declared a regular quarterly cash dividend of $0.45 per share for Q1 2026.
- The dividend is payable on April 9, 2026, to shareholders of record as of March 19, 2026.
- VICI owns 93 experiential assets, including iconic properties like Caesars Palace Las Vegas and MGM Grand.
- The portfolio comprises 54 gaming properties and 39 other experiential properties across the U.S. and Canada.
- VICI's properties are occupied under long-term, triple-net lease agreements with industry-leading operators.
